PhD in Pharmacy Pharmaceutics from Monad University

Monad University is a private university located in Uttar Pradesh, India. It offers a Doctor of Philosophy (PhD) program in Pharmacy Pharmaceutics.

The PhD in Pharmacy Pharmaceutics is a research-based program that focuses on developing new drug delivery systems, analyzing drug stability, and evaluating the pharmacokinetics and pharmacodynamics of drugs. The program is designed to provide students with the necessary skills and knowledge to conduct independent research and contribute to the field of pharmaceutics.

The program typically takes 3-5 years to complete, depending on the student’s progress. During the program, students will undertake advanced coursework in pharmaceutics, research methodology, and data analysis. They will also conduct original research under the guidance of a faculty supervisor and present their findings in a thesis or dissertation.

Graduates of the PhD in Pharmacy Pharmaceutics program can pursue careers in academia, pharmaceutical research and development, and regulatory affairs. They can also work in government agencies, such as the Food and Drug Administration (FDA), or in the private sector in pharmaceutical companies or consulting firms.

PhD in Pharmacy Pharmaceutics From Monad University Eligibility:

To be eligible for the PhD in Pharmacy Pharmaceutics program at Monad University or any other institution, specific requirements and criteria must typically be met. While I can provide general information on eligibility, it’s important to note that the specific eligibility criteria may vary, and it is always recommended to consult the official website or admissions department of Monad University for the most accurate and up-to-date information.

Here are some general eligibility criteria that are commonly observed for a PhD in Pharmacy Pharmaceutics program:

  1. Educational Qualifications: Applicants should hold a Master’s degree (M.Pharm or equivalent) in Pharmacy or a related field from a recognized university. The Master’s degree should typically be in a relevant area such as Pharmaceutics, Pharmaceutical Technology, Industrial Pharmacy, or Drug Delivery Systems.
  2. Minimum Marks: Candidates are usually required to have a minimum percentage or grade point average (GPA) in their Master’s degree. The minimum marks required may vary, but it is generally around 55-60% or a CGPA of 6.0 on a scale of 10.
  3. Entrance Exam: Some universities may require applicants to appear for an entrance examination such as the Graduate Pharmacy Aptitude Test (GPAT) or a university-specific entrance test. The performance in the entrance exam may be considered during the selection process.
  4. Research Proposal: Applicants are often required to submit a research proposal outlining their research objectives, methodology, and the significance of their proposed research topic in the field of Pharmacy Pharmaceutics.
  5. Experience: Prior research or work experience in the field of Pharmacy Pharmaceutics may be advantageous but is not always mandatory.
  6. Interview: Shortlisted candidates may be called for a personal interview as part of the selection process. The interview aims to assess the candidate’s research aptitude, subject knowledge, and suitability for the program.

PhD in Pharmacy Pharmaceutics From Monad University Syllabus:

While I don’t have access to the specific syllabus for the PhD in Pharmacy Pharmaceutics program at Monad University, I can provide you with a general idea of the topics typically covered in such a program. The actual syllabus may vary depending on the university and specific program structure. It’s best to refer to the official website or contact the admissions department of Monad University for the most accurate and up-to-date syllabus information.

Here are some common areas of study that may be included in the syllabus for a PhD in Pharmacy Pharmaceutics:

  1. Advanced Pharmaceutics:
    • Advanced drug delivery systems
    • Pharmaceutical formulation development
    • Drug stability and degradation kinetics
    • Drug release mechanisms and kinetics
  • Pharmaceutical Biotechnology:
    • Biopharmaceutics and pharmacokinetics
    • Biotechnology applications in drug delivery
    • Biomaterials and tissue engineering
    • Pharmaceutical nanotechnology
  • Advanced Pharmaceutical Analysis:
    • Analytical techniques in pharmaceutics
    • Quality control and quality assurance
    • Analytical method development and validation
    • Impurity profiling and characterization
  • Drug Discovery and Development:
    • Drug discovery process and target identification
    • Preformulation studies and drug development
    • Pharmacogenomics and personalized medicine
    • Clinical trials and regulatory affairs
  • Pharmaceutical Manufacturing and Technology:
    • Pharmaceutical process engineering
    • Scale-up and optimization of drug manufacturing processes
    • Good Manufacturing Practices (GMP) and quality management systems
    • Process validation and technology transfer
  • Research Methodology and Biostatistics:
    • Research design and planning
    • Experimental methods and statistical analysis
    • Literature review and scientific writing
    • Ethical considerations in research
  • Elective Courses:
    • Depending on the program structure, students may have the option to choose elective courses related to their research interests. These may include specialized topics such as targeted drug delivery, controlled release systems, pharmaceutical nanotechnology, or pharmaceutical regulatory science.
